Yukkuri Shiteitte ne
Created on 2chan during the early 2000s, Yukkuris are parodies of Touhou characters—disembodied heads presumably based on manjū (a bean pastry). Their name derives from the Japanese word for "slow[ly]" and are used as a way to either mock players frustrated with Touhou's variable difficulty or trolling in general. Lorewise some yukkuris are kind while others are deemed "shitheads". Some fans draw them as beloved pets; others subject them in situations of torture, abuse and mutilation.

Rick roll
Rick Astley, the famous singer of the hit song "Never Gonna Give You Up," became an internet sensation in the late 2000s when people started using his music video as a prank. The prank, known as "Rick rolling," involves tricking someone into clicking on a link that leads to Astley's music video instead of the content they were expecting.
